|  | 19 | #  Display how many nodes have a given GPFS file system mounted, | 
|---|
|  | 20 | #  and optionally list the nodes that have the file system mounted. | 
|---|
|  | 21 | # | 
|---|
|  | 22 | #  Usage: | 
|---|
|  | 23 | # | 
|---|
|  | 24 | #    mmlsmount {Device | all | all_local | all_remote} [-L] | 
|---|
|  | 25 | #              [-C {all | all_remote | ClusterName[,ClusterName...]}] | 
|---|
|  | 26 | # | 
|---|
|  | 27 | #  where: | 
|---|
|  | 28 | # | 
|---|
|  | 29 | #    Device | all | all_local | all_remote | 
|---|
|  | 30 | #       specifies the device(s) for which mount information is sought. | 
|---|
|  | 31 | #       all denotes "all file systems known to this cluster". | 
|---|
|  | 32 | #       all_local denotes "all file systems owned by this cluster". | 
|---|
|  | 33 | #       all_remote denotes "all file systems not owned by this cluster". | 
|---|
|  | 34 | # | 
|---|
|  | 35 | #    -C {all | all_remote | ClusterName[,ClusterName...]} | 
|---|
|  | 36 | #       specifies the clusters for which mount information is requested. | 
|---|
|  | 37 | #       If one or more ClusterName is specified, only the names of nodes | 
|---|
|  | 38 | #       that belong to these clusters and have the file system mounted | 
|---|
|  | 39 | #       will be displayed.  The dot character (".") can be used in place | 
|---|
|  | 40 | #       of the cluster name to denote the local cluster. | 
|---|
|  | 41 | # | 
|---|
|  | 42 | #       -C all_remote denotes all clusters other than the one from which | 
|---|
|  | 43 | #       the command is ussued (this cluster). | 
|---|
|  | 44 | # | 
|---|
|  | 45 | #       -C all refers to all clusters, local and remote, that can have | 
|---|
|  | 46 | #       the file system mounted.  -C all is the default. | 
|---|
|  | 47 | # | 
|---|
|  | 48 | #    -L specifies "list the nodes that have the device(s) mounted". | 
|---|
|  | 49 | # | 
|---|
|  | 50 | #  Note: | 
|---|
|  | 51 | #    If invoked by a non-root user, the command is executed on the local | 
|---|
|  | 52 | #    node "as-is".  In particular, the local configuration information may | 
|---|
|  | 53 | #    not be up-to-date.  There is no attempt to find an active GPFS daemon | 
|---|
|  | 54 | #    on another node.  Non-root users are not allowed to invoke commands on | 
|---|
|  | 55 | #    other nodes. |
